Subject: Re: Best place to hook the Security Call

The Struts tags support the getRole, etc.; which are part of JAAS.
Also, extending JAAS w/ Struts is easy, for example detecting a new
login and adding additional information. (all in the basicPortal.com
bestPractice Struts sample)
